Personal growth is important! It is a major part of self-care. By growing physically, mentally, and emotionally, it is easy to forget about our spiritual side. We need to grow there, too.

The Believers Instruction Book: Living Edition says in Ephesians 4:15 that we will speak the truth in love, growing in every way more and more like Christ.  We don’t want to be like those believers in Hebrews 5:12-14 who should be teaching others but are like babies who need milk and cannot eat solid food. Arise2 Grow More is a site for maturing believers to get solid food, to be encouraged, and inspired to grow spiritually.

According to 2 Peter 3:18, we must grow in the grace and knowledge of our Lord and Savior Jesus Christ. Spiritual growth is a process, a step towards God. We need to train ourselves to be godly. With each step we take, does it move us closer to God or away from Him? Arise2 Grow More is a site to help others move closer to our Creator. As we move closer to the King of kings, His kingdom grows more because we want to share this Good News we experienced with others.

At the end of each post will be a prayer to help get the conversation with God started, verses to look up, a song to listen to, and a call to action. The hope is that these little actions will start a habit to spend time with God and see God working in your lives.

Who is behind Arise2 Grow More

The Holy Spirit has been guiding Imelda Weaver to create Arise2 Grow More for quite a long time but Imelda has difficulty listening or as some would say, “is stiff-necked”. She has a stubborn streak in doing things her own way. Her husband, Scott, had advised her to start a blog as he was doing in 2014, but she decided to take the ‘easier’ path of starting a Google+ account. That went quite well until Google+ was sunsetted in 2019.

Again Scott encouraged Imelda to start a blog but she decided to start using Facebook Notes instead. When Facebook took Notes away, she started a Facebook Group but no one joined until this year, 2023.

Imelda finally felt ‘called’ to start a blog. The Holy Spirit had been patiently putting little encouragements/nudges in her devotionals, Bible reading, Sunday messages, songs on the radio, and conversations to do her part to glorify God by sharing what He has done in her life and what she has learned in her studies and her research about the Creator of the universe.

She has not gone to seminary so we highly recommend that you do as the people of Berea in Acts 17:11. Imelda has participated in The Theology Program with her church, currently has 233 perfect weeks of reading the Bible, volunteered in Sunday School since her oldest was a toddler, and wrote for teen/tween magazines.

Imelda is a very shy and private person so blogging is so out of her comfort zone. With the spiritual growth she has gone through, she is able to step out in faith to share what God is doing in her life. She is still learning to obey the Holy spirit and not to be so stubborn.

When not studying the Scriptures, Imelda assists Scott in any way she can so that he can work on his business and ministry. She was jealous about how Scott was enjoying helping people with his consulting/coaching business. So when an opportunity to start a business of her own came up, she said, “Yes!” and signed up.

Scott wanted 4 kids and Imelda didn’t want any so God blessed them with 2 kids now grown. They moved halfway across the country during the first year of COVID to be closer to their youngest and because  Scott felt the Holy Spirit leading them and Imelda finally agreed.
